Æ20 - Philip I ΕΠ ΑΝΤΕΡ ΑΡΧ ΑΠΠΙΑΝΩΝ

Features

Issuer Appia (Conventus of Synnada)
Emperor Philip I (Marcus Iulius Philippus) (244-249)
Type Standard circulation coins
Years 244-249
Composition Brąz
Weight 4.55 g
Diameter 20 mm
Shape Okrągły (nieregularny)
Technique Młotkowana
Demonetized Yes
Number
N#
502216
References RPC Online VIII# 20638
Roman Provincial Coinage (https://rpc.ashmus.ox.ac.uk/)

Obverse

Popiersie Boule z woalem i draperią, po prawejAutomatically translated

Lettering: ΒΟΥΛΗ

Reverse

Dionizos stojący po lewej, trzymający kantar i tyrsusAutomatically translated

Script: grecki

Lettering: ΕΠ ΑΝΤΕΡ ΑΡΧ ΑΠΠΙΑΝΩΝ

Unabridged legend: ἐπὶ Ἀντέρωτος ἄρχοντος Ἀππιανῶν

Mint

Appia, Phrygia, Turkey

Comments

vA, Phrygien I, 175-81; Martin, Demos, s. 159-60, Appia 2
